Output 93d3be574dae48e2decf722735c16f06b1869d893db248692efd4ca8f58da695:45

value
66266
script pubkey
OP_0 OP_PUSHBYTES_20 c3e084cd152baba33f5f553c36665c4429bdb20a
address
bc1qc0sgfng49w46x06l257rvejugs5mmvs2syt9ra
transaction
93d3be574dae48e2decf722735c16f06b1869d893db248692efd4ca8f58da695
spent
true